Funding & Fees Guide for Northlands Nursing Home

  • Funding Types Accepted
  • Self funding (Private)
  • Local Authority with Top-Up
  • Local Authority
  • NHS Continuing Healthcare (CHC) Funding
  • Weekly Charges per Person
    • Self-Funded Residential Care £970 – £1,045
    • Self-Funded Residential Dementia Care £1,025 – £1,100
    • Self-Funded Nursing Care £1,075 – £1,150
    • Self-Funded Nursing Dementia Care £1,075 – £1,250
    • RESPITE Self-Funded Residential Care £970 – £1,045
    • RESPITE Self-Funded Residential Dementia Care £1,025 – £1,100
    • RESPITE Self-Funded Nursing Care £1,075 – £1,150
    • RESPITE Self-Funded Nursing Dementia Care £1,075 – £1,150
  • Fees are reviewed on a regular basis and are subject to change to reflect the costs of delivering high quality care. Please contact the home manager to discuss resident needs and potential fees.


  • (these prices are only a guideline, please contact Northlands Nursing Home to find out the exact price for your requirements)

Overall Experience  Overall Experience 3.0 out of 5

Staffing levels are a concern to me. Most of the regular staff have been there for a long time and are welcoming and helpful. However, more recently, there are lots of unfamiliar faces about the place, and the staff look weary and rushed. Standards of cleanliness around the home have slipped a little
also. Having said that, my mum seems relatively happy and relaxed around the regular staff, who seem to work incredibly hard.

Reply from Andrew Kerr, Director at Northlands Nursing Home

Thank you for taking the time to provide a review of Northlands. I am glad that your mother is happy and relaxed with our regular staff. I can assure you that staffing levels are reviewed regularly with the manager to ensure that we maintain safe levels.
However, we are currently in the biggest crisis that I have ever seen in social care. Recruitment and retention of staff are extremely difficult leading to increased reliance on agency staff. Staff sickness levels this autumn and winter have also been at unprecedented levels with the combination of COVID, Flu and other winter viruses. To try and address these issues, we have increased pay rates by 11.7% for care staff, introduced incentives and bonuses as well as encouraged take-up of the COVID and flu boosters. I hope additional Government funding will be forthcoming in 2023 to help us find a permanent solution to the problems that are affecting the whole social care sector.

My husband suffers from advanced Parkinson's Disease with associated dementia. He also arrived at the home from hospital with eight pressure sores, one of them so bad that the NHS said it could never be healed. Northlands staff have healed them all. All the staff know my husband well and treat him with
the greatest kindness and respect. Within their busy schedules, they find time to pop in and chat with him, as well as deal with all his complex medical needs.
Of course, there are difficulties, largely due to the Government's failure to fund the care sector adequately. The staff and management at Northlands do an amazing job of coping with these problems, which are not of their own making. I would give them all medals (not to mention much better pay and career prospects). They so deserve it.

Reply from Andrew Kerr, Director at Northlands Nursing Home

Thank you for your review. I hope that the government also listens to your views about the need to fund social care properly.

Overall Experience  Overall Experience 3.0 out of 5

The new owners are investing extensively in the property and it would be good to see them investing to the same extent in the staff, their most important asset. Happy, supported, well-trained staff are key to the residents’ comfort and wellbeing.


The middle floor can be a lonely place in the evenings

with few staff around and I am told it can take time to respond to residents’ call alarms when, for example, they need to go to the bathroom.


There can be a lack of consistency regarding communication and delivering information. The staff, however, do care very much and do their best especially when they appear to be a little short on the ground.


Reply from Andrew Kerr, Director at Northlands Nursing Home

Thank you for your review.


Parkside Care acquired Northlands in March 2017 and as you note we have started a major refurbishment program. Our investment in the fabric of the building will make the home fit for purpose and improve facilities for both residents and staff.


We have also undertaken a staff survey and have made some improvements to staffing levels and conditions for staff. We will continue our development program with guidance from staff meetings and resident forums.


Our new nurse call system can monitor the response times of staff and the management will be reviewing this closely.

Detailed Breakdown of Review Score

The maximum Review Score for a Care Home is 10, which is made up from the Average Rating of Reviews (maximum of 5 points) and the Number of Reviews (maximum of 5 points) in the last 24 months:

  • a) 5 Points are available for the Average Rating from all Reviews in the last 24 months.

    The Average Rating of 4.400 for Northlands Nursing Home is calculated as follows: ( (14 Excellents x 5) + (14 Goods x 4) + (2 Satisfactorys x 3) ) ÷ 30 Ratings = 4.4

  • b) 5 Points are available for the number of Positive Reviews in the last 24 months. A Positive Review is defined as any Review with an 'Overall Experience' of '4' or '5' (out of a max rating '5').

    The 3.635 Points relating to the number of positive Reviews for Northlands Nursing Home is based on 3 positive Reviews in the last 24 months and is calculated as per below:

    The 5 points available are broken down as follows:

    • i) 4 points are available for the first 10 Positive Reviews in the last 24 months; 3 points for the first Positive Review, and then 0.125 Points for each of the next four Positive Reviews and then 0.1 Points for the next five Positive Reviews. (1st = 3.000, 2nd = 0.125, 3rd = 0.125, 4th = 0.125, 5th = 0.125, 6th = 0.100, 7th = 0.100, 8th = 0.100, 9th = 0.100, 10th = 0.100) 3 + 0.125 + 0.125 = 3.25

    • ii) 1 point is available for the number of Positive Reviews reaching 20% of the registered maximum number of service users in the last 24 months. If this number is partially reached, then that proportion of 1 point is given. eg a Care Home registered for a maximum of 50 service users has to reach 10 Positive Reviews to receive 1 point, if it has 7 reviews it will receive 0.7 points. 20% of the 39 registered maximum number of service users is 7.8. 3 Positive Reviews ÷ 7.8 = 0.385

  • When a Review is submitted by someone who has previously submitted a Review, only the latest Review will count towards the Review Score.

  • If a Care Home does not have a review in the last 24 months, then it will not have a Review Score.
